Pioneer was the first brand to bring Apple CarPlay to existing vehicles in 2014, and now the company is back with another CarPlay first. The new Pioneer Sphera is the first aftermarket system with Dolby Atmos support and is now available for purchase.

At CES 2026, Pioneer introduced the new Sphera aftermarket in-dash receiver that supports premium CarPlay:
Building on decades of audio innovation, Pioneer, a global leader in automotive sound systems and aftermarket vehicle electronics, is introducing the world’s first aftermarket spatial audio in-dash receiver SPHERA featuring Dolby Atmos® playback in Apple CarPlay. Until now, in-car Dolby Atmos has only been available in models equipped with Dolby Atmos-supported sound systems. With SPHERA, Pioneer expands access to Dolby Atmos through an aftermarket solution that can be installed in millions of existing vehicles, delivering an impressive sound experience using the vehicle's existing speakers.
The Pioneer Sphera (model DMH-WT8000NEX) is now available for purchase.
Previously, Dolby Atmos and Spatial Audio were only offered in certain vehicles with limited options. Apple also provides Dolby Atmos and Spatial Audio support in audio products like AirPods and HomePods.
Pioneer brings Dolby Atmos and Spatial Audio to all vehicles with an optimized 4-channel solution using existing front and rear speakers. This is made possible thanks to Pioneer’s “Pure Autotuning” technology.
Vehicle cabins vary greatly in size, shape, and material, and aftermarket upgrades can further affect acoustic variables. To account for and adapt to these differences, PURE Autotuning technology precisely adjusts time alignment, frequency response, and channel levels to optimize performance and place the listener in an acoustic center position. This level of accuracy is essential for delivering a Dolby Atmos experience that stays true to the creative intent of musicians and content creators.
Sphera comes with a 10.1-inch HD capacitive screen featuring advanced Pioneer capabilities:
Taking advantage of the large screen size, split-screen mode divides part of the screen for easy access to main features and control options. The integrated Pioneer Luminous Bar adds a subtle visual signature to the dashboard and offers Music Synchronization Mode to sync your music with Enhanced Visual Mode for navigation support. Wireless connectivity makes the experience seamless with wireless CarPlay, wireless Android Auto™, and Bluetooth®. Designed for universal aftermarket mounting, SPHERA adapts to a wide range of vehicles with minimal modification, ensuring impressive sound reaches drivers.
Crutchfield is selling the new Pioneer Sphera at a retail price of $1,299.99, and it is now shipping.
